About Us:

Learfield is the leading media and technology company powering college athletics. Through its digital and physical platforms, Learfield owns and leverages a deep data set and relationships in the industry to drive revenue, growth, brand awareness, and fan engagement for brands, sports, and entertainment properties. With ties to over 1,200 collegiate institutions and over 12,000 local and national brand partners, Learfield’s presence in college sports and live events delivers influence and maximizes reach to target audiences. With data-based solutions for a 365-day, 24/7 fan experience, Learfield enables schools and brands to connect with fans through licensed merchandise, game ticketing, donor identification for athletic programs, exclusive custom content, innovative marketing initiatives, NIL solutions, and advanced digital platforms. Since 2008, it has served as title sponsor for the acclaimed Learfield Directors’ Cup, supporting athletic departments across all divisions.

The Manager, Partner Development supports a Director, Partner Development on a portfolio of Power 4 schools, while independently managing their own territory of key Division I partners. This role requires strong relationship management skills, a deep understanding of SIDEARM’s digital products, and a commitment to driving partner success, adoption, and revenue growth.

Key Responsibilities

  • Support the Director in managing Power 4 partnerships, including renewals, reporting, and strategic engagement
  • Lead the day-to-day management of an assigned group of Division I partners
  • Conduct partner meetings (virtual and in-person) to review performance, introduce solutions, and identify growth opportunities
  • Understand partner goals and align SIDEARM products and services to meet objectives
  • Drive product adoption and upsell opportunities across assigned accounts
  • Gather and relay partner feedback to internal teams for continuous improvement
  • Set and manage expectations regarding project timelines, deliverables, and capabilities
  • Act as the first escalation point for issues within assigned accounts
  • Collaborate with Support, Development, Product, and Project Management teams
  • Create and deliver presentations, proposals, and best practices documentation
  • Perform additional duties as needed to support team and company initiatives

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ree required
  • 5+ years of experience in collegiate athletics, digital sports, or related fields
  • Strong knowledge of digital technology within college athletics
  • Proven success in relationship management and strategic account service
  • Excellent communication, presentation, and organizational skills
  • Ability to manage multiple accounts in a fast-paced environment
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(PowerPoint, Excel, Word)
  • Ability to travel and represent SIDEARM at partner locations and events
  • Adaptability to different partner styles and organizational structures

About SIDEARM Sports

The team at SIDEARM provides the technology platform that powers the official websites, mobile apps, statistical integration, live audio and video streaming of more than 1,500 collegiate athletic partners across the nation, including 300 NCAA Division I programs, and over 50 of the Power 4 athletic departments. We are proud that the work we do is experienced by millions of sports fans each year.
